Understanding the Prompt

Before you begin writing, take time to dissect the scholarship prompt. The GCSAA Legacy Awards aim to support students pursuing education in golf course management. Consider what this means for you: How does your background align with the goals of this scholarship? Reflect on your experiences in the field and how they have shaped your aspirations.

Brainstorming Across the Four Buckets

Organize your thoughts by exploring four key areas that will inform your essay:

  • Background: What experiences have influenced your interest in golf course management? Consider family influences, educational experiences, or early exposure to the industry.
  • Achievements: Identify specific accomplishments that demonstrate your commitment and capability in this field. Use metrics or outcomes to highlight your contributions, such as projects completed, leadership roles, or relevant work experiences.
  • The Gap: Reflect on what you currently lack in your education or experience that this scholarship could help you address. Be specific about how further study will bridge this gap.
  • Personality: Share personal anecdotes that reveal your values and character. What drives you? What unique perspectives do you bring to the field of golf course management?

Creating an Outline

Once you have gathered your material, create an outline that organizes your thoughts logically. A suggested structure might be:

  1. Introduction: Open with a compelling scene or moment that captures your interest in golf course management.
  2. Background: Discuss your formative experiences and how they led you to this path.
  3. Achievements: Highlight key accomplishments, using specific examples and metrics.
  4. The Gap: Explain your educational needs and how this scholarship will help you meet them.
  5. Personality: Include personal stories that showcase your values and aspirations.
  6. Conclusion: Reflect on your journey and express your commitment to making a positive impact in the industry.

Drafting Voice and Style

As you draft your essay, maintain an active voice and focus on clarity. Avoid clichés and vague statements. Instead, aim for specificity and authenticity in your writing. Each paragraph should convey a single idea, with transitions that guide the reader through your narrative. Remember to reflect on your experiences and articulate why they matter in the context of your goals.

Revision and the “So What?” Factor

After drafting your essay, take a step back to revise with a critical eye. Ask yourself: What insights have I gained? How do my experiences connect to my future goals? Ensure that each section of your essay answers the “So what?” question, demonstrating the significance of your journey and aspirations.

Common Pitfalls to Avoid

Be mindful of these common mistakes:

  • Avoid starting with generic statements or clichés.
  • Do not include invented facts or embellish your experiences.
  • Steer clear of passive voice; use active constructions to emphasize your role in your achievements.
  • Ensure your essay is cohesive and focused, with each paragraph contributing to the overall narrative.

FAQ

What is the GCSAA Legacy Awards scholarship?
The GCSAA Legacy Awards scholarship is offered by the Golf Course Superintendents Association of America to support students pursuing education in golf course management. The scholarship awards $1,500 to help cover educational costs.
Who is eligible to apply for this scholarship?
Eligibility for the GCSAA Legacy Awards typically includes students enrolled in programs related to golf course management or related fields. Check the scholarship's official guidelines for specific eligibility criteria.
When is the application deadline?
The application deadline for the GCSAA Legacy Awards is April 15, 2026. Make sure to submit your application and essay by this date to be considered for the scholarship.
